Postmarks

Postmarks is an open source server written in Node.js that supports a single user writing bookmark posts, with tags, descriptions and search. It syndicates via Atom feeds and federation over ActivityPub, making it possible to follow using Mastodon and similar platforms.

Postmarks was originally published on Glitch, but can run on any server that supports Node.js, directly or behind a reverse proxy.
